Get Rid of What You Don't Need

Sort through your collection and get rid of any worn-out, stained hats or hats that you seldom wear. Throw away any headwear that is no longer useable and give the remainder. After you've sorted all of the hats you wish to bring, organise them by brim size. Those with original hat boxes should be set aside. Get rid of any shoes that haven't been worn in a long time. Give it to a charity or to other members of your family. Remember that you can always buy new shoes and caps, but the less you have to pack, the easier it will be to move.

Best Packing Methods

When packing shoes, start by stuffing the toes with socks or other small items to fill up extra space. This will help them stay in shape and avoid getting squished during transport. You can also place shoe trees inside of the shoes to help maintain their form.  

Pack hats by folding them gently into thirds width-wise, then placing them inside of a hat box or another container that is sturdy enough to protect them from damage. If you don't have a hatbox, use tissue paper or bubble wrap to protect them.

Pack Your Special Items With Care

Because heels are more readily destroyed than other sorts, take your time here if you don't want to be a damsel in distress. All of the pieces with laces should be linked together, and you should figure out a way to keep the other sorts together, perhaps by using the same wrapping, packing, and so on. If you don't have the original hat boxes and need to pack any high-quality hats, make sure to treat each one with special care. Crushed tissue paper should be used to fill the inside of the crown. 

Label Everything

Label everything you pack, whether it's boxes, containers, or anything else. Labelling can help you keep track of everything not just throughout the packing process but also during transportation. It will be easier for you to distinguish which containers hold your shoes and hats, allowing you to correctly load them into the moving truck. Additionally, if everything is correctly labelled, unpacking will be a breeze once you have moved into your new house.
